medicine | expression of glutathione synthetase is observed in 70% of hepatocellular carcinoma patients, 46.7% of chronic hepatitis B stage 4 patients and 38% of chronic hepatitis B stage 1-3 patients. There is significant difference between hepatocellular carcinoma samples and non-tumor tissues. Serum glutathione synthetase levels are increased in hepatocellular carcinoma and chronic hepatitis B stage 1-4 patients. There are significant differences among all samples, except chronic hepatitis B stage 1-3 versus chronic hepatitis B stage 4. Hepatocellular carcinoma, chronic hepatitis B stage 1-4 and AFP are significantly associated with serum glutathione synthetase levels. In hepatocellular carcinoma group, TNM and Child-Pugh are significantly associated with glutathione synthetase levels. Expression of glutathione synthetase is increased in hepatocellular carcinoma, liver cirrhosis, and chronic hepatitis B | Homo sapiens |
